Energy calculated at PBEPBE/6-311G*
 hartrees
Energy at 0K-2283.995629
Energy at 298.15K-2283.993209
HF Energy-2283.995629
Nuclear repulsion energy8311.895865
The energy at 298.15K was derived from the energy at 0K and an integrated heat capacity that used the calculated vibrational frequencies.
